On 4/3/2012 10:59 AM, Antonio Cortes Alhambra (INCATEL) wrote:
> Swap this lifetimes
>
> Phase 1 - 28800 seconds
>
> Phase 2 - 3600 seconds
>
> phase 1 lifetime must be greather tan phase 2 lifetime.
>
> This values are ok
